Problem statement
You have to design and contrast a statically determinate and stable bridge truss using limited number of popsicle sticks and other limited material such that your bridge fulfills followings dimensional criteria –
- Span(length) of the bridge= 60cm
- Clear width of the bridge= 10cm
- Height of the bridge = 10-20 cm(so that a vehicle having a height 10 cm may pass from one end to another end of the deck without any obstacle )
Note: position of the members in the deck should be such that there should be no difficulty in placing a metallic plate of size 20cm* 6cm for applying load using a chain and pan arrangement at the middle of the depth(during final testing of the bridge)

Logistics to be provided:
Popsicle sticks(500 sticks and each having 24 cm length and 1.5 mm diameter ), epoxy, fevicol , pencil , eraser, scale, sand paper, tape, thread.
Note: use of any extra material from your side would lead to immediate disqualification
